Synopsis

In 1972, the tiny windswept town of DeClare, Oklahoma, was consumed by the terrifying disappearance of Nicky Jack Harjo. When he was no more than a baby, his pajama bottoms were found on the banks of Willow Creek. Nearly 30 years later, Nicky mysteriously returns in this intriguing and delightfully hypnotic tale, full of the authentic heartland characters that Billie Letts writes about so beautifully.

About the Author

Billie Letts is the author of numerous highly acclaimed short stories and screenplays. Her first novel, Where The Heart Is, was an Oprah Book Club Selection, sold more than three million copies, and became a major motion picture. Her second novel, The Honk and Holler Opening Soon, was named the first 'Oklahoma Reads Oklahoma' selection. A former University professor, Billie Letts lives in Tulsa with her husband, Dennis.
